I will use A3S as an example since so few have cleared it.
Using FFLogs as a reference for maximum class potential - it appears that they calculated A3S as a minimum ilvl of 203-205 without including healer DPS.
~ Max potential minus Healer DPS at at rate of 88% for gear.
This is with classes pushing their max potential, lining up buffs, pot usage, and Tank in DPS stance using as much DPS gear to meet HP limits. This will still just barely meet a win during Enrage cast.
- Without Tanks optimizing for as much DPS as possible I'd suspect that A3S was geared towards i206 at maximum play. Which is basically getting as much gear as you can get without beating A3S and still just barely meeting Enrage.
